The WALI Dummy Fake Simulated Surveillance Security Camera set offers a convincing look with its dome style and an LED light that mimics real cameras, making it effective for deterring unwanted visitors. Made from durable materials, these cameras feel solid and are designed to withstand outdoor conditions, supported by an IP65 rating which ensures resistance to rain and dust.
Installation is straightforward—you simply screw them onto a ceiling or wall without any wiring, as each camera runs on two AAA batteries (not included), making them easy to place anywhere. The package also includes warning stickers to enhance the illusion of active security. These cameras do not record video or pan/move, so they rely solely on visual deterrence.
Battery life should be minimal since the LEDs are the only active feature requiring power. For a low-cost way to increase your security presence, especially when combined with real cameras, this set is practical and effective. However, if you need actual monitoring or smart features, you will need to consider other options.
The WaitScher Solar Motion Lights Outdoor with Fake Camera is designed to combine illumination and the deterrent effect of a fake security camera. It boasts an impressive 1800 lumens brightness, ensuring ample lighting for dark areas around your home. The use of a high-efficiency solar panel means it can charge even on cloudy days, supported by a robust 3600mAh battery with a long lifespan of 24,000 hours.
The product is equipped with a motion sensor that activates up to 26 feet, providing 30 seconds of light per activation, which is useful for security purposes and energy conservation. The dummy camera, featuring a red indicator light, adds a layer of perceived security that can deter potential intruders without the higher costs associated with real security systems. In terms of durability, it is IP67 waterproof and can operate in temperatures ranging from 5°F to 120°F, making it suitable for year-round outdoor use.
Installation is straightforward, with multiple mounting options available, including wall and floor mounts. The material quality, while being plastic, is designed to be shock-resistant and durable. It comes with a generous 2-year warranty, adding reassurance for users. This product is particularly well-suited for homeowners looking for an affordable security solution for patios, decks, gardens, driveways, and pathways, especially those who appreciate the simplicity of solar-powered devices.
The BNT Solar Powered Fake Security Camera is a practical choice if you want to deter potential intruders without spending a lot on a real security system. Its realistic design, including an antenna and flashing red light, can easily fool would-be thieves. Made from durable ABS plastic, this camera is both waterproof and dustproof, making it suitable for various indoor and outdoor environments.
However, it’s important to note that while the unit includes a solar charging function, it requires 3 AAA rechargeable batteries (not included) for consistent operation, especially at night or during cloudy weather. This might be a minor inconvenience for some users. Installation is straightforward since no wiring is involved. The package comes with four cameras, mounting brackets, screws, and warning stickers, so you have everything you need to set it up right away.
On the downside, the lack of an actual motion sensor, despite the product listing mentioning a motion sensor, could be misleading for some buyers. Additionally, while it has an IP54 rating for weather resistance, which is decent, it may not withstand extremely harsh weather conditions. Those seeking a budget-friendly way to boost their home security might find this product particularly beneficial, but it’s essential to manage expectations regarding its capabilities as a non-functional, dummy camera.
